#c63e67 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c63e67 is composed of 77.6% red, 24.3%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.7% magenta, 48%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 341.9 degrees, a saturation of 54.4% and a lightness of 51%. #c63e67 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7cce with #8d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#c63e67 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c63e67 has RGB values of R:198, G:62, B:103 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.48,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 12992103.

Shades and Tints of #c63e67
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040102 is the darkest color, while #fcf4f6 is the lightest one.
